学术论文

      基于Cortex-M4处理器的μC/OS-Ⅲ移植分析与实现

      Analysis and implementation of porting μC/OS-Ⅲ based on Cortex-M4 processor

      摘要:
      介绍了新一代实时操作系统μC/OS-Ⅲ和Cortex-M4处理器,从移植视角出发,系统地分析了 μC/OS-Ⅲ的体系结构,详细论述了 μC/OS-Ⅲ在基于Cortex-M4内核的STM32 F407 ZGT6芯片上的移植实现过程.经测试,验证了移植的正确性和稳定性,该移植方法对Cortex-M4构架的其他处理器的移植具有指导意义.
      Abstract:
      The paper introduces a new generation of RTOSμC/OS-III and Cortex-M4 processor. From the perspective of transplantation, the system structure of μC/OS-III is analyzed systematically. Then it describes the implementation procedure of portingμC/OS-III to STM32 F407 ZGT6 that based on Cortex-M4 processor in detail. Finally, it verifies porting is correct and stable by testing. So the method can be used for porting on other processors based on Cortex-M4 architecture.
      作者: 张扬 李恒 谭洁
      Author: ZHANG Yang LI Heng TAN Jie
      作者单位: 昆明理工大学 信息工程与自动化学院,昆明,650500
      年,卷(期): 2017, (6)
      分类号: TP316.2
      在线出版日期: 2018年1月4日
      基金项目: 国家自然科学基金资助项目